1. What Are Gel Particles in TPU Paint Protection Film?
Definition
Gel particles are small areas of TPU material that were not fully melted or properly dispersed during the manufacturing process.
These defects may come from:
- TPU resin inconsistency
- Polymer degradation
- Material contamination
- Poor filtration during extrusion
How Do Gel Defects Look?
Typical characteristics of TPU gel particles include:
- Small transparent or white dots
- Random distribution across the film
- Slight raised feeling when touched
- More visible under direct sunlight or strong lighting
2. What Causes TPU Gel Defects?
Raw Material Quality
The quality of TPU raw material plays an important role in the final appearance and performance of paint protection film.
High-quality TPU requires:
- Stable resin formulation
- Proper drying process
- Consistent molecular structure

3. What Are Surface Sink Marks in PPF?
Unlike gel particles, surface sink marks are caused by manufacturing conditions during the film-forming process.
They usually appear as:
- Small surface depressions
- Uneven light reflection
- Shadow-like spots under certain lighting conditions
4. Causes of Surface Sink Marks
Uneven Cooling
During cast film production, uneven cooling can create stress differences inside the TPU film.

Extrusion Stability
Film uniformity can also be affected by:
- Melt pressure fluctuations
- Temperature control issues
- Incorrect line speed matching
5. Gel Particles vs Sink Marks: Key Differences
| Feature | Gel Particles | Sink Marks |
|---|---|---|
| Cause | Raw TPU material | Manufacturing process |
| Shape | Raised dots | Small dents |
| Location | Inside the film | Surface of the film |
| Touch | Slight bump | Usually smooth |
| Appearance | Bright spots | Shadow spots |
